Greater Victoria Flower Count: Get Out and #ExploreSooke

Tuesday, March 5, 2024 – The Greater Victoria Flower Count is an annual light-hearted promotion sponsored and organized by local businesses, Destination Greater Victoria and The Greater Victoria Chamber of Commerce. The goal is normally to bolster community pride and increase awareness of Greater Victoria as an attractive shoulder-season tourism destination and an incredible place to work, live and play. The goal in 2024 is to spread spring cheer to the residents of Greater Victoria, including Sooke, and encourage them to stop and count the flowers while out in their communities.

In 2024, blossoming blooms will be counted from 7 a.m. on March 6 to 4 p.m. on March 13!

2023 Counts

  • 2023 “Bloomingest Community”: Sidney: 7,580,503,851
  • 2023 Community Runner Up: North Saanich: 7,558,368,163
  • 2023 Winning School: Hillcrest Elementary
  • 2023 Total Municipal Blooms Counted: 33,386,900,082
